The Punishment of the Jews

-They have been treated so badly they have been dehumanized

‘the first soldier did not see the bread-he was not hungry-but the first Jew saw it’-Sunk back to something that is almost not human. Have sunk back to their basic necessities.

‘The soldiers pulled over to share some food and poke at the package of Jews.-the Jews are now just a package. Not human.

Page 7: Jew- Born into a family who follows the Jewish religion Has Jewish heritage Converted to a Jewish religion Because you do not have to follow the Jewish

Hans Hubeman-Gives the old Jew bread. By giving the old man bread, he is giving him kindness.

‘If nothing else the old man would die like a human. Or at least the thought he was a human. Me? I’m not so good that’s a good thing.

The old man dies as a human because he has been shown kindness by Hans.

It is not such a good thing because humans are generally the people who have caused this. Hitler has gone so far as to disgrace the human name. As Death sees it. So why would a Jew want to die the same way Hitler would.

Bread as a Symbol

-Bread is a Symbol for Hope that is given to the Jews.

Hope that they can make it through this.

‘Presented a piece of bread like magic’-The bread is the magic of hope.

This magic allows the Jews to become at least human.

The Community-oblivious to the crimes done to the Jews.-May agree or disagree with the crimes done to he Jews. Their views may be split.-May be too scared of the punishment they will receive-Ignore the crimes done to the Jews

This is shown Hans Huberman is ‘Helped back to safety’ by people from the community. After giving the old Jew bread. While others called him a ‘Jew lover’.

Page 11: Jew- Born into a family who follows the Jewish religion Has Jewish heritage Converted to a Jewish religion Because you do not have to follow the Jewish

Nazi Soldiers-Blindly follows Hitler's command, no matter what atrocities they have to commit.-Share Hitler’s hatred towards the Jews.

‘The Jew was whipped six times’ as the soldier yelled ‘You swine you filth’.

Again the Jew is dehumanized. He is now just an animal.

‘They had the Fuhrer in their eyes’

They have been so brain washed that they now see and act as Hitler would.
